1. 立即执行函数,会生成私有变量,防止变量污染2. 闭包 内部函数可以访问外部函数的变量,把函数返回去,闭包可以保护内部的变量,但也会造成内存的泄漏 ,所以需要不用之后置为null3. 原型链 3.1 构造函数里的属性的优先级比原型链的高 3.2 面向对象编程的时候, js没有类的概念,可以用函数替代 3.3 constructor实际就是对应的那个函数 
 32位CPU所含有的寄存器有: 4个数据寄存器(EAX、EBX、ECX和EDX) 2个变址和指针寄存器(ESI和EDI) 2个指针寄存器(ESP和EBP) 6个段寄存器(ES、CS、SS、DS、FS和GS) 1个指令指针寄存器(EIP) 1个标志寄存器(EFlags) 1、数据寄存器 数据寄存器主要用来保存操作数和运算结
ES5和ES6那些你必须知道的事儿ES5新增的东西二、对象方法  1、Object.getPrototypeOf(object)    返回对象的原型 function Pasta(grain, width) { this.grain = grain; this.width = width; } var spaghetti = new Pasta("wheat", 0.2);
 es中有很多的配置都让大家忍不住去调优,因为也许大家都太过于迷恋性能优化了,都认为优化一些配置可以大幅度提升性能,就感觉性能调优像个魔法一样,是个万能的东西。但是其实99.99%的情况下,对于es来说,大部分的参数都保留为默认的就可以了。因为这些参数经常被滥用和错误的调节,继而导致严重的稳定性问题以及性能的急剧下降。 1、jvm gc jvm使用垃圾回收器来释放掉不
32位CPU含有的寄存器4个数据寄存器 (EAX, EBX, ECX和EDX)2个变址 寄存器(ESI和EDI)2个指针寄存器 (ESP和EBP)6个段寄存器 (ES, CS, SS, DS, FS和GS)1个指令指针寄存器 (EIP)1个标志寄存器 (EFLAgs)数据寄存器数据寄存器主要用来保存操作数和运算结果等信息, 从而节省读取操作数所需占用总线和访问存储器的时间32位CPU有4个32位的
中关村在线消息:今日据悉,微星公司宣布对旗下部分台式游戏PC进行更新,增加了英特尔Comet Lake CPU与Nvidia的GeForce系列显卡的搭配。微星新款游戏台式电脑亮相 配备英特尔第十代CPU这些型号正在美国组装,这意味着如果你在美国订购,应该会更快地的买到它们。该系列的第一款也是最大的设备是Aegis R和Aegis RS,这两款机型采用的是相同的机箱,其容积为50升,主要区别在于主
1. 寄存器、内存和寻址1.寄存器和内存寄存器(Register)是 CPU的组成部分,是有限存储容量的告诉存储部件,用来暂存指令、数据和地址。一般的IA-32即x86架构的处理器中包含以下几个寄存器:通用寄存器:EAX、EBX、ECX、EDX、ESI、EDI。栈顶指针寄存器:ESP、栈底指针寄存器:EBP。指令计数器:EIP(保存下一条即将执行的指令的地址)。段寄存器:CS、DS、SS、ES、F
API创建索引及文档找文档网上的es教程大都十分老旧,而且es的版本众多,个别版本的差异还较大,另外es本身提供多种api,导致许多文章各种乱七八糟实例!所以后面直接放弃,从官网寻找方案,这里我使用elasticsearch最新的7.6.1本来讲解。1、进入es的官网指导文档 https://www.elastic.co/guide/index.html2、找到 Elasticsearch Cl
现象:往es7集群中推数时,发生如下情况接口出现很多400发现集群中某台机器cpu被怼爆发生fullGC产生400报错的原因是es7做了熔断优化,当jvm内存使用超过阈值,为了避免丑陋的oom,会直接限流并抛出EsRejectedExecutionException。我们强硬的关掉了这个配置,因为我们的推数有失败重试。产生fullGC是因为一个bulk批处理的数据量太大,我们一个文档1.5M,80
说到电脑问题,就不得不提蓝屏的问题。最近有位朋友的电脑开机的时候,并没有进入正常的启动程序,反而进入了蓝色界面,显示代码0x000000ed,不知道为什么会这样,也不知道如何去解决。下面就来看看蓝屏0x000000ed的原因和解决方法详解吧!蓝屏代码0x000000ed的原因详解!蓝屏现象,是我们在使用电脑中最常见的一种启动问题,而蓝屏显示的代码就是帮助我们去了解蓝屏的原因以及解决方法的主要依据。
教你挑选G0步进处理器 首先,我们先来回顾一下G0步进的一些情况。步进,是英文Stepping的中文翻译,通常我们所说的“Core Stepping”指的就是“核心步进”,步进表示的含义是芯片因某种外在因素的变化而导致的物理或者电气特性的变化的产物。在7月22号之后,Intel开始陆续将其旗下的产品从原本的B-3更换为新的G0步进。   升级至G0步进,代表着In
Elasticsearch 性能优化Elasticsearch 是当前流行的企业级搜索引擎,设计用于云计算中,能够达到实时搜索,稳定,可靠,快速,安装使用方便。作为一个开箱即用的产品,在生产环境上线之后,我们其实不一定能确保其的性能和稳定性。如何根据实际情况提高服务的性能,其实有很多技巧。这章我们分享从实战经验中总结出来的 elasticsearch 性能优化,主要从硬件配置优化、索引优化设置、查
对于一些不经常接触电脑的小伙伴来说,可能会被CPU那些后缀字母搞得头昏眼花,什么9400F、3500X 、3400G、10700K、10900KF。现在就说一说这些常见的后缀字母都是什么意思。英特尔:英特尔中常见后缀有F和K。X、XE只在高端CPU中出现,比如i9-10940X、i9-10980XE。后缀为X表示这是款至高性能的处理器,属于一人之下,万人之上的那种。而为XE后缀的表示这是款同系列中
二手CPU值得买吗?众所周知,不少装机用户可能因为预算的原因,可能会考虑二手硬件,理论上二手CPU无疑相比全新更加便宜,但是CPU这玩意真的有很多例外,有些二手CPU还真的没有全新划算,较老型号的intel处理器出现了价格严重倒挂,如果购买二手CPU不想交智商税就看这篇文章,装机之家晓龙带你避坑。 二手CPU值得买吗 就在近期,就有用户想要组装一台搭配i7处理器的游戏主机,但是呢,预算有
腾讯云服务器ECS存储增强通用型实例规格族g7se实例CPU处理器采用Intel Xeon(Ice Lake) Platinum 8369B,基频2.7 GHz,全核睿频3.5 GHz,单实例顺序读写性能最高可达64 Gbit/s,IOPS最高可达100万,阿里云百科来详细说下存储增强通用型实例规格族g7se性能特性、使用场景及不同ECS实例规格网络收发包PPS、连接数、云盘IOPS等性能参数:
在进行科学计算的时候,需要的核心越多越好,也就是说在进行服务器CPU的选择时,尽量遵循最大化多核心性价比的原则。考虑的cpu为多核心志强以及EPYC,家用级处理器并不考虑,原因:1. 核心较少且相对比较保值,多核心性价比较差2. 服务器级别CPU有更多PCIE通道数,后期如果有深度学习意向也方便安装多张显卡。最近性价比较为突出的CPU:2969v3, 2666v3,2670v2,EPYC7601。
为了让英创更多的Linux主板能够满足工业应用在实时性上的要求,我们在ESM6800H/E和ESM7000系列主板的内核(4.9.11)基础上,使用了针对该版本的RT PATCH(实时补丁),将系统升级为实时Linux系统,让主板能够满足一定的实时性需求。ESM6800H/E板载Crotex A7架构CPU(iMX6ULL),主频为792MHz,是一款性价比极高的工控主板。而ESM7000系列主板
一、Java API操作 1. API基本操作 2. 条件查询QueryBuilder 3. 映射相关操作 二、IK分词器 1. IK分词器的安装 2. IK分词器的使用 三、Logstash 1. Logstash简介 2. Logstash 安装 3. Logstash 配置 四、Kibana 一、Java API操作Elasticsearch的Ja
最常用的ES6特性let, const, class, extends, super, arrow functions, template string, destructuring, default, rest arguments这些是ES6最常用的几个语法,基本上学会它们,我们就可以走遍天下都不怕啦!我会用最通俗易懂的语言和例子来讲解它们,保证一看就懂,一学就会。 let, cons
背景1.ES PAAS管理的集群升级了100+,从7.5升级到7.17 (保证每个大版本最终仅维护一个小版本集群)2.由于业务使用差异大,也出了不少问题,前面的文章也有提到过Integer类型字段使用terms查询效率低的情况3.这里再分析一个CPU、IO飙升的场景现象1.用户报障:“ES集群写入吞吐量变小了”2.观察下来发现确实CPU高了,IO也有明显抖动  排查与分析1.发
  • 1
  • 2
  • 3
  • 4
  • 5